General Requirements

Students admitted to the BMCB Program must have an undergraduate degree in biological or physical sciences and must have completed course work in mathematics through calculus, chemistry, biochemistry, and molecular biology. Coursework in physical chemistry is also encouraged. Students can be admitted with course deficiencies under some circumstances.

Application Procedures

Please send all application materials to the BMCB program coordinator at the address below. There is a $50 application fee that is required by the Graduate College.

STEP 1: Complete the BMCB application online.

STEP 2: Arrange for additional material to be sent directly to the address shown below. To expedite this process, you may send unofficial copies of your transcripts and standard test scores. Official copies will be required to finalize your admission. Additional material to be sent directly to the department includes:

  • Three letters of recommendation from people who are familiar with your work (one of these letters should be from your research advisor, if applicable). Remember to give your letter writers plenty of notice. Click here to download the forms for letters of recommendation.
  • Official transcripts of all college and university work.
  • Official GRE results (general exam is required and a subject exam is optional).
  • Official TOEFL results (for international students only).
  • Graduate College application which can be completed online by domestic and international applicants provided you are paying with a credit card.
